I guess I'd like to see more variation in ship exteriors as the game develops. I know that the combination of weapons, paint jobs, decals and eventually thrusters are going to make a visible difference. But I'd like to see things go further than that. I'd like to see external fuel tanks, scanning paraphernalia, shield generators etc. etc. mean that load out choices make individual ships visually unique. Would also like to see ship names painted on hulls with nose art etc. Not criticising the alpha, just hoping for more as the game develops.
Also mentioned a long time ago having modular cockpits which could change ship appearance and offer functionality / stats benefits & drawbacks.
